About This Book
Think you can outsmart an Ewok? This book proves you can survive the wildest dangers of the Star Wars galaxy, from sneaky bounty hunters to exploding space stations. Knowing these survival tricks could mean the difference between becoming a hero or getting eaten!
Quick Assessment
This humorous and informative guide introduces middle-grade readers to survival skills within the Star Wars universe. It offers practical advice on navigating various fictional threats, featuring engaging illustrations and step-by-step instructions. Suitable for ages 9-12, it encourages problem-solving and creativity without real-world violence.
Why we rated Star Wars How Not to Get Eaten by Ewoks and Other Galactic Survival Skills 9LP
Star Wars How Not to Get Eaten by Ewoks and Other Galactic Survival Skills is written at a Level 4-5 reading level across 128 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 5.5 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Star Wars How Not to Get Eaten by Ewoks and Other Galactic Survival Skills works for readers up to grade 6.5.
We rate Star Wars How Not to Get Eaten by Ewoks and Other Galactic Survival Skills as 9LP ("Light — Physical") because the content sits in the "Mild" range — mild conflict — the kind a child encounters in normal play and sibling life.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ly mild; no single dimension stands out as a concern.
No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the mild intensity score.
Thematically, Star Wars How Not to Get Eaten by Ewoks and Other Galactic Survival Skills explores adventure, humor, science & nature, and fantasy world-building —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
